Janet Matthews Obituary

Matthews, Janet NOKOMIS, Fla. Janet "Jan" Blasdell Matthews, age 76, of Nokomis, passed away Monday, April 1, 2013 in Venice, Fla. She was born May 6, 1936 in Fort Ann, N.Y., the daughter of the late Elmer Jay and Gertrude (Needham) Blasdell. A graduate of Fort Ann High School, class of 1953, she attended Albany Business College, graduating in 1955 with an associates degree. It was here she met the love of her life, her future husband Ted. Jan was a loving, stay at home mom during the years that her children were young. Later, she worked as an executive secretary for the NYS Department of Labor in Albany, and retired after many years of service. Jan lived in Clifton Park from 1973 to 1998 and was a communicant of St. Edward the Confessor Church. She loved the beach and lived the past 15 years in Nokomis, returning each summer to her second home in Brant Lake, where she shared very special times with her family. Jan enjoyed spending time with friends, playing dominos, cards or going out to dinner. She loved her books, puzzles, crosswords and suduko. Her greatest joy was having her large and loving family together for a holiday, special event or even an evening meal. Jan was loved by many and will be dearly missed. She is survived by her devoted husband of 55 years, Theodore "Ted" Joseph Matthews II; children, Terri (Joseph) Leputa of Dayton, Ohio, Theodore (Ann) Matthews III of Nokomis, Joan (Chad) Finck of Clifton Park, Paul (Chrissy) Matthews of Clifton Park, Mark (Tammy) Matthews of Ballston Spa, Jay (Tiffany) Matthews of Albany, Carolyn (Bob) Renzi of Clifton Park, and Nancy (Rich) Buehler of Clifton Park; 20 grandchildren; six great-granchildren; and sister, Joan (Jim) Murphy of Warrensburg. She is preceded in death by her parents, Elmer and Gertrude (Needham) Blasdell and brothers, Corliss, Walter, and Arthur. A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ated by Rev. Patrick Butler on Saturday, April 6, 2013 at 9 a.m. at St. Edward the Confessor Church, 569 Clifton Park Center Road, Clifton Park. Relatives and friends are welcomed to attend the calling hours on Friday, April 5, 2013 from 4 to 8 p.m. in the chapel in St. Edward's Church. Interment will be held immediately following the Mass in Holy Sepulchre Cemetery, Rensselaer.
